Season Ticket Holder Information Session Held

March 14, 2019 - Ontario Hockey League (OHL)
Kitchener Rangers News Release


An information session that was held on Thursday, March 14 at The Aud provided details to patrons on OHL Facility Upgrades (presented by Athletica Sport Systems Inc.) and the Smoke Free Ontario Act (presented by the Region of Waterloo).

Following the meeting, the Kitchener Rangers are pleased to announce the City of Kitchener has procured Athletica Sport Systems to upgrade the board & glass system in the Dom Cardillo Arena.

The Ontario Hockey League has adopted a policy for facilities to upgrade to a National Hockey League approved board & glass system by the 2021 season. The City of Kitchener continues to demonstrate its ongoing commitment to player & spectator safety by completing this initiative by the beginning of the 2019-20 season.

The new system has cutting-edge technology, featuring:

- Soft Cap on top of the boards that absorb 96% more force than standard systems

- Acrylic shielding with one-of-a-kind impact-absorbing design

- Shielding and board systems flex upon impact easing strain on player's bodies

- Curved acrylic on ends of benches

Also presented in the meeting was information on The Smoke Free Ontario Act. The Act prohibits smoking, including tobacco and cannabis, whether it be recreational or medicinal, and vaping in any public area within 20 metres of the perimeter of a City-owned property line.

Effective June 1, 2019 a NO REENTRY POLICY will be implemented for all special events at The Aud. This will include Kitchener Rangers games beginning in the 2019-20 season.
